You need support help to narrow down where the bug might be, or in how to move past it. Could be a lot of causes here and support techs can help you narrow things down. Start with the possibilities in

http://support.mozilla.com/en-US/kb/Bookmarks+and+toolbar+buttons+not+working+after+upgrading

Since your home page won't save either, and that's stored in a separate file, there may be a general problem writing to the "profile" directory.

http://support.mozilla.com/en-US/kb/Preferences+are+not+saved

It's extremely unlikely that the preferences and places files both were corrupted at the same time (since corruption of either is rare) so check that your profile files are not read-only. If the articles above don't help try http://support.mozilla.com/en-US/kb/Ask+a+question

your places.sqlite file could be locked, first of all try in Safe Mode:
http://support.mozilla.com/kb/Safe+Mode
What security (antivirus/spyware) software are you using? it could cause a file to be in use and not accessible.
Creating a new profile could help too: http://support.mozilla.com/kb/Profile
